Director Lewis Von Thaer reports acquisition of phantom stock units in American Electric Power Co Inc.

Summary

  • On March 31, 2024, Lewis Von Thaer, a director of American Electric Power Co Inc. (AEP), acquired 493.61 phantom stock units.
  • These stock units are payable in cash or shares upon termination of service, unless the director has elected to defer payment.
  • Following the transaction, Von Thaer directly owns 4,308.06 shares of AEP common stock.
  • The AEP stock price at the time of the transaction was $86.1.
